At the main forum of the Mobile Cloud Conference held on May 8, 2026, China Mobile officially launched the Mobile Model Management Platform (MoMA). The platform aims to popularize artificial intelligence technology across all industries by integrating more than 300 mainstream AI models, enabling the widespread application of intelligent services.

The MoMA platform has built a model service system featuring "one-time access, intelligent selection, universal availability, and secure trust," significantly lowering the threshold for AI applications. Users need only access the platform once through a unified API gateway to use all model resources on the platform. Currently, MoMA has integrated multiple outstanding models, including China Mobile's self-developed "Jiu Tian" large model. These models cover capabilities such as text generation, speech processing, and multimodal understanding, meeting the needs of multiple fields such as government affairs, finance, industry, healthcare, and education.

To optimize user experience, MoMA has pioneered an intelligent routing engine that automatically analyzes user needs and flexibly switches between the most suitable models based on three strategies: "cost priority," "effect priority," and "balance priority." In case of timeout or failure, the platform can switch within seconds to ensure uninterrupted business operations. Meanwhile, MoMA's self-developed inference engine and intelligent routing technology based on domestic computing power have successfully reduced the cost per Token by about 30% and significantly reduced resource consumption.

To ensure data security, MoMA has introduced the "Confidential Model" service, deploying the model in a secure environment to ensure that data is not leaked during the computation process. This service is particularly suitable for scenarios with high requirements for data security, such as government affairs and finance.

MoMA also emphasizes efficient token operations, achieving "pay-as-you-go" through real-time streaming billing, effectively solving the problem of resource waste in traditional package-based billing models. In addition, the platform has established a dedicated risk control mechanism to ensure clarity and transparency in each Token's usage and provides full-chain observability to monitor key indicators in real time, providing support for users' business decisions.
